Firefox 3 uses a lot less memory

It seems Mozilla has done a better job on Firefox 3 than the current versions. ZDNet has tested Firefox 3.0 beta 1 and reports the new version uses significantly less system memory than Firefox 2.0.0.9.

Initially the memory consumption of Firefox 3 looked higher but further testing revealed the new browser doesn't suffer from spiraling memory consumption when the browser is under heavy load. Memory usage after opening 12 pages into the browser and wait 5 minutes:
  • Firefox 2.0.0.9: 103,180KB
  • Firefox 3.0 beta 1: 62,312KB
  • Internet Explorer 7: 89,756KB
